About Us
Our program, hosted, is renowned for its commitment to welcoming and guiding individuals interested in Judaism, including those considering conversion, and fostering a vibrant community. With over 650 students annually, our program serves as a hub for learning and connection in Southern California.
Role Overview
As a Part-Time Instructor for the Miller Introduction to Judaism Program, you will play a pivotal role in providing a rich and inclusive educational experience. Utilizing our established curriculum, you will guide students in exploring the history, traditions, and practices of Judaism, empowering them to embrace Jewish life both in and outside the classroom. We offer courses in both English and Spanish, reaching students globally through virtual Zoom sessions scheduled across various time zones.
Key Responsibilities
Lead engaging and informative sessions for an 18-week program cohort.
Thoroughly prepare for classes, familiarizing yourself with curriculum materials.
Offer support and guidance to students beyond class hours, addressing inquiries about conversion, rituals, and theological concepts.
Cultivate a welcoming and participatory class environment, ensuring all students feel valued and included.
Adhere to program and university guidelines while facilitating classes.
Fulfill additional duties as needed.
Qualifications
Rabbinical Ordination from an accredited institution, with knowledge spanning Conservative, Reform, and Reconstructing denominations.
Demonstrated expertise in Jewish practices and customs.
Minimum one year of teaching experience at the introductory level.
Proficiency in building rapport and fostering community in online settings.
Familiarity with Zoom features such as breakout groups, screen-sharing, and participant management.
Sensitivity and respect for the diverse backgrounds and identities of students.
